Why is a Moisture Barrier Necessary Under Click and Lock Flooring?
Moisture is the enemy of most flooring materials, and click-and-lock flooring is no exception. Exposure to excessive moisture can lead to several problems:
- Warpage and Buckling: Moisture absorbed by the flooring can cause the planks to expand and buckle, ruining the floor's appearance and potentially making it unstable.
- Mold and Mildew Growth: Damp conditions create an ideal environment for mold and mildew to thrive, posing health risks and further damaging the flooring.
- Premature Failure: Consistent exposure to moisture significantly reduces the lifespan of click-and-lock flooring, necessitating costly replacements.
A high-quality moisture barrier acts as a protective shield, preventing moisture from reaching the flooring and causing these issues. This is especially crucial in basements, bathrooms, or areas prone to high humidity.
What Types of Moisture Barriers are Suitable for Click and Lock Flooring?
Several options are available, each with its own pros and cons:
- 6-mil Polyethylene Sheeting: This is a common and cost-effective choice. It's easy to install and provides a good level of moisture protection. However, it's not as durable as some other options.
- Vapor Barriers: These specialized barriers are designed to prevent moisture vapor from passing through the subfloor. They are particularly useful in areas with high humidity.
- Self-Adhesive Underlayment: These combine a moisture barrier with cushioning for added comfort and sound insulation. They are easier to install than separate sheeting and underlayment but can be more expensive.
- Rubber Underlayment: This option is known for superior sound dampening but may be less effective in high moisture scenarios.
How Do I Install a Moisture Barrier Under Click and Lock Flooring?
The installation process is relatively straightforward:
- Prepare the Subfloor: Ensure the subfloor is clean, dry, level, and free of debris. Any cracks or imperfections should be repaired before installing the barrier.
- Unroll the Moisture Barrier: Overlap the seams by at least 6 inches to create a watertight seal. Use tape to secure the edges and prevent gaps. For polyethylene, consider using vapor barrier tape.
- Install the Underlayment (if applicable): Follow the manufacturer's instructions for installing any underlayment. Often this involves rolling it out, overlapping seams and taping as needed.
- Install the Click and Lock Flooring: Begin installation according to the flooring manufacturer's instructions.

Is a Moisture Barrier Necessary in All Situations?
While a moisture barrier is highly recommended for most installations, its necessity depends on several factors:
- Climate: In drier climates, the need for a moisture barrier may be less critical.
- Subfloor Material: Concrete subfloors are more prone to moisture problems than wood subfloors.
- Location: Basements and ground-level floors are at a higher risk of moisture issues.
Consult a flooring professional if you're unsure whether a moisture barrier is required in your specific situation.
How do I test for subfloor moisture?
Testing subfloor moisture is crucial. Several methods exist:
- Moisture Meter: This provides a quantifiable measurement of the moisture content.
- Plastic Sheet Test: Place a plastic sheet on the subfloor for 24-48 hours. If condensation forms, there is excess moisture.
- Visual Inspection: Check for visible signs of water damage, such as staining or warping.
